Heim  >  Artikel  >  Web-Frontend  >  FCKeditor praktische Fähigkeiten_CSS/HTML

FCKeditor praktische Fähigkeiten_CSS/HTML

WBOY
WBOYOriginal
2016-05-16 12:10:411142Durchsuche

Originaltext: http://3rgb.com, Autor: Lemon Garden Owner
Bitte bewahren Sie diese Informationen für den Nachdruck auf

FCKeditor hat bisher Version 2.3.1 erreicht. Viele Leute haben es im Grunde genommen in ihre eigenen Projekte integriert, und viele weitere große Websites profitieren davon. Ab heute werde ich nach und nach einige der Techniken vorstellen, die ich bei der Verwendung von FCKeditor gelernt habe. Natürlich sind diese tatsächlich in FCK enthalten, aber viele Leute haben sie bei der Verwendung von FCK nicht entdeckt :P

1. Öffnen Sie zum richtigen Zeitpunkt den Editor

Oft müssen wir den Editor nicht direkt beim Öffnen der Seite öffnen, sondern ihn nur bei Bedarf öffnen. Dies sorgt für eine gute Benutzererfahrung und kann andererseits die Notwendigkeit für FCK beseitigen Öffnen Sie die Seite beim Laden. Der Einfluss der Geschwindigkeit, wie in der Abbildung gezeigt

FCKeditor praktische Fähigkeiten_CSS/HTML

Klicken Sie auf die Schaltfläche „Editor öffnen“, um die Editoroberfläche zu öffnen

FCKeditor praktische Fähigkeiten_CSS/HTML

Implementierungsprinzip: Verwenden Sie die JAVASCRIPT-Version von FCK, um beim Laden der Seite eine versteckte TextArea-Domäne zu erstellen (FCK ist nicht geöffnet). Der Name und die ID dieser TextArea müssen mit dem Namen von übereinstimmen Wenn Sie dann auf die Schaltfläche „Editor öffnen“ klicken, verwenden Sie die Methode „ReplaceTextarea()“ von FCK, um einen FCKeditor zu erstellen. Der Code lautet wie folgt:

Code kopieren Der Code lautet wie folgt:




FCKeditor 2 :


此部分的详细DEMO请参照_samples/html/sample11.html,_samples/html/sample11_frame.html

4.

L'application FCKeditor est basée sur FCKeditor. La version publiée另一个问题:到底允许谁能上传?到底谁能浏览服务器文件?

之前刚开始用FCKeditor时,我就出现过这个问题,还好NetRube(FCKeditor中文化以及FCKeditor ASP版上传程序的作者)及时提醒了我,做法是去修改FCK上传程序,在里面进行权限Il s'agit d'un fichier fckconfig.js. Le fichier fckconfig.js est utilisé pour créer un fichier fckconfig.js.的控制这种配置么?事实上,是有的。

在fckconfig.js里面,有关于是否打开上传和浏览服务器的设置,在创建FCKeditor时,通过程序来判断是否Il s'agit d'une application fckconfig.js.的上传和浏览设置全设为false,接着我使用的代码如下:

<%

Dim oFCKeditor

Définissez oFCKeditor = Nouveau FCKeditor
avec oFCKeditor

.BasePath = fckPath .Config("ToolbarLocation") = "Out:fckToolBar" si demande. cookies(site_sn)("issuper")="oui" puis .Config("LinkBrowser") = "true" .Config("ImageBrowser") = "true" .Config("FlashBrowser ") = "true"
.Config("LinkUpload") = "true"
.Config("ImageUpload") = "true"
.Config("FlashUpload") = "true" end if
.ToolbarSet = "Basic"
.Width = "100%"
.Height = "200"

.Value = ""
.Create "jcontent"
%>



JAVASCRIPT版本:




复制代码


代码如下:


      var oFCKeditor = new FCKeditor( 'fbContent' ) ;

      <%if power = powercode then%>
      oFCKeditor.Config['LinkBrowser'] = true ;
      oFCKeditor. Config['ImageBrowser'] = true ;
      oFCKeditor.Config['FlashBrowser'] = true ;      oFCKeditor.Config['LinkUpload'] = true ;      oFCKeditor.Config['ImageUpload'] = true ;      oFCKeditor.Config['FlashUpload'] = true ;      <%end if%>      oFCKeditor.ToolbarSet = 'Basic' ;      oFCKeditor.Width = '100%' ;
      oFCKeditor.Height = '200' ;
      oFCKeditor.Value = '' ;
      oFCKeditor.Create() ;



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n